South Brisbane is linked to the CBD by several bridges, including the Go Between Bridge (toll road), Merivale Bridge (rail), William Jolly Bridge (road), Kurilpa Bridge (pedestrian/cycling), Victoria Bridge (road) and Goodwill Bridge (pedestrian/cycling).

South Brisbane had a population of 14,292 people in the 2021 census. The median age is 30 years, which is about seven years younger than the national median, reflecting a youthful community.
